Timanfaya National Park
Explore Lanzarote’s wild west at Timanfaya National Park, a place straight out of a science fiction movie with its Mars-like terrain! At this park, you will be able to learn everything there is to know about the raw power of volcanoes and the heat beneath the earth. After your tour, make sure to grab a bite at El Diablo, where the chef will use the heat provided by the volcano to cook your meal. Don’t miss out on this alien world!

Fundación César Manrique
Just north of Arrecife, you will be able to find a museum dedicated to Lanzarote’s most influential artist, César Manrique. The museum, formerly the artist’s home, showcases Manrique’s style of seamlessly blending architecture with nature, and is totally worth a visit for anyone looking to experience something unique to the island.

Mirador del Río
Up north in Lanzarote? Head over to Mirador del Río, a look-out spot designed by our friend Manrique, built literally into the cliff. This spot additionally features a café that provides you with front-row seats to the Atlantic and neighboring islands. Relax, grab a drink, and enjoy the view!
Jameos Del Agua
Looking for something totally unique? Check out Jameos del Agua in Lanzarote’s northeast. This cave is another one of Manrique’s works, and features an underground lake, restaurant, concert hall and even a swimming pool! Definitely worth a visit if you’re into unique spots that mix the natural with the man-made.

Cueva de los Verdes
Another spot definitely worth checking out is Cueva de los Verdes, up north near Punta Mujeres. Explore this massive lava tube by joining one of the guided tours and discover the island’s volcanic past in an action-packed journey underground!

Museo Atlántico
Ever wanted to explore an art gallery beneath the waves? Check out Museo Atlántico, off the southern coast. This underwater museum, located 12 meters beneath the waves, consists of a series of sculptures that over time have become part of the ocean life. Prepare your diving or snorkeling gear and dive down for an unforgettable experience!
Natural Swimming Pools
If you’re looking for a chill swim, hit up the natural swimming pools in Lanzarote. You’ll find them in spots like Punta Mujeres and Los Charcones, made from volcanic rocks – great for a peaceful swim or just kicking back, especially if you want to avoid the crowds of the busy beaches.
Teguise
If you’re searching for a historical experience, Teguise, the island’s old capital, has exactly what you’re looking for. Its buildings and streets have been excellently preserved, offering a window into the past. And don’t forget to check out LagOmar near Nazaret – a stunning place carved from lava flows and caves, another gem by Manrique. For lovers of history and culture, Teguise is an unmissable destination!
Arrieta
Just south of Punta Mujeres lies Arrieta, this charming little coastal village, known for its relaxed atmosphere and beautiful beach, Playa de la Garita. It’s a great spot for families and those looking to experience the island’s traditional charm.
